When your Garmin watch software update fails, it usually means the firmware installation was interrupted during download or installation. This commonly happens due to low battery, poor Bluetooth connection, or the watch being moved away from your phone during the update process.

How to Fix Error Code Software update failed

  1. Charge Your Watch Completely

    Never attempt a software update with less than 25% battery as this can corrupt the firmware.
  2. Keep Watch on Charger During Update

  3. Position Phone Close to Watch

  4. Close Unnecessary Apps

  5. Check Wi-Fi Connection

  6. Restart Garmin Connect App

  7. Initiate Software Update Again

    Do not move the watch or phone, answer calls, or use other apps during the update as this can cause it to fail again.
  8. Wait for Complete Installation

  9. Perform Factory Reset if Still Failing

    Factory reset will erase all data on the watch. Sync with Garmin Connect first to back up your activities and settings.

When to Call a Professional

Contact Garmin support if the watch fails to update after multiple attempts, shows error messages during boot, or becomes completely unresponsive. If the watch is still under warranty, professional diagnosis may be covered.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why does my Garmin watch software update keep failing?
Common causes include low battery, poor Bluetooth connection, unstable Wi-Fi, or interruptions during the update process. Ensure your watch is charged, close to your phone, and on a stable internet connection.
How long should a Garmin watch software update take?
Most Garmin watch updates take 15-45 minutes depending on the update size and your internet speed. Large firmware updates may take up to an hour to download and install completely.
Can I use my Garmin watch while it's updating?
No, avoid using your watch during software updates. Keep it on the charger and don't press any buttons or move it away from your phone until the update completes successfully.
What happens if my Garmin watch dies during a software update?
If the battery dies during an update, the watch may become unresponsive or stuck in update mode. Charge it fully, then try restarting by holding the power button for 15 seconds before attempting the update again.
Will I lose my data if the Garmin software update fails?
Typically no, but it's always wise to sync your watch with Garmin Connect before updating to back up your activities, settings, and personal data in case a factory reset becomes necessary.
